For the full picture, the annual tuition and fees for full-time undergraduates at Worsham College of Mortuary Science are listed below.
Required fees account for came to $1,000; the rest is tuition itself.
| Most Recent Reported Year | |
|---|---|
| Tuition | $19,500 |
| Fees | $1,000 |
| Total | $20,500 |
These figures are tuition and fees only — they do not include room and board costs.
This is how tuition at Worsham College of Mortuary Science has shifted over the past few years.
| Year | Tuition |
|---|---|
| Three Years Ago | $22,800 |
| Two Years Ago | $23,800 |
| One Year Ago | $23,800 |
| Most Recent Year | $19,500 |
Most recently, tuition declined relative to the prior year, which is unusual and may reflect a restated figure.
